Parent’s Priceless Privilege

The little child that’s by your side is placing trust in you.

He wants to watch just what you do, and then he’ll try it too.

His little hand is placed in yours to lead him in the way.

His voice is waiting now for you to help him sing and pray.

His little mind is seeking truth, so teach him while he’s small.

God gave this precious child to  you – He’ll give you grace for all.

~found in  Rod & Staff preschool activity book
